Every so often one of our ESXi 3.5 hosts loses VI client access with 'a connection failure occurred', however I can telnet to port 902 and pull a banner.
The guests appear unaffected and are running fine.
The only step that resolved this last time was a full reboot of the host. Restarting mgmt agents and network appeared to do nothing.

VI Client uses port 902 to connect to VM console, and 443 to manage ESX.
